Leadership Review Briefing — Heads of Department, Fennick & Hale

Quick read before Thursday: the Calloway product line pricing hasn't moved in three years, and margins are getting squeezed by input costs on the coated variants. Tomas's team ran the numbers — a 6% list increase across the line, with volume discounts protected for our top-tier accounts, recovers most of the gap without much churn risk. Rollout would start with the Westbrook catalog refresh. The strategic context for the timing is outlined below.

board note of fafog-yahap: Project Rusdor slips by a full year because of the audit delay.

Facilities ticket — Halewick Tower, night shift.

Issue: support team reporting east stairwell reader rejecting badges after midnight. Reader was reset this morning; firmware updated. Overnight crew should now badge as normal. If the reader fails again, use the manual keypad by the fire door — do not prop the door. Log any further failures with the time and badge name. Temporary keypad code for the fallback door is below.

door code, tajeg-fawip: bdg-K-62

## Further Reading

If you're poking at FeedSentry for the security review, a few pointers before you dive in. The XML parsing layer is the spicy part — we deliberately disabled external entity resolution, and the fuzzing harness under `tests/fuzz` covers most of the enclosure-URL edge cases. The threat model doc from the Larkwood team is worth a skim too, especially the section on malicious redirect chains in feed enclosures. Everything else, including past audit notes and open findings, lives on the internal page here.

operations page: https://jenkins.zemvarcloud.local/job/merge_requests/repo/build/73930b4b30f0a8ed

## Deployment — Restockly planner

Single binary, runs behind the Fernhollow gateway. No inbound ports except the gateway-terminated listener. Machine inventory syncs pull-only over mutual TLS; the planner never pushes to machines. Secrets come from the vault sidecar at boot, nothing on disk. Audit events go to the append-only sink; rotation handled upstream. Review scope: the planner trusts inventory payloads after signature check, nothing else. The deployed instance uses the following configuration.

settings of kajep-kajop:
OLIDOR_LOG_LEVEL=info
OLIDOR_METRICS_HOST=metrics.olidor.norvacorp.corp
OLIDOR_POOL_SIZE=4